Meeting with BPP University London: Aiming new bond in Law’s international partnership

02/27/2023
FEBRUARY 27 - UEF International Institute had a working session with BPP University, UK. During the conference, representatives of both institutions discussed potential international collaborative programs.
Delegates from UEF and BPP University discussed potential collaborations

On behalf of UEF, there were Dr. Do Huu Nguyen Loc – Vice President & Director, UEF International Institute; Ms. Huynh Tu Anh – Deputy Director, UEF International Institute; and Ms. Chu Ngoc Anh Thu – Staff of UEF International Institute.
Representing BPP University, there was Ms. Maggie Yeong – Student Recruitment Manager APAC, along with the staff in Vietnam.
UEF presented gifts to academic partner

At the beginning of the working session, UEF’s representatives conveyed greetings and provided an outline of UEF as well as other partnership prospects with BPP.
In response, Ms. Maggie Yeong briefly introduced BPP’s education programs. According to the representatives of BPP, their university always aims to expand international corporations. Also, BPP recognizes a great deal of potential in Asia in general, particularly in Vietnam.
The two parties proposed cooperating on articulation programs, allowing students to complete their third (2+2), final year (3+1), or 4+0 degree programs at a partner university, with a priority in Law, and exchange students, faculty members.

Both parties discussed articulation programs, with a focus on the Law aspect

As the first private university, BPP University London was established in 2007 in the city of London, United Kingdom. The university has campuses in Manchester, Leeds, Cambridge, Birmingham, and Bristol. BPP places a strong emphasis on creating groups of courses in administration, finance, and law that all meet rigorous British certification standards, etc.
The meeting laid a solid foundation for future collaborations, paving the way for students from both institutions to emerge in an international academic environment.
